Looking to relocate to Amsterdam - Does anyone know when the entry-level recruitment cycle starts for most consultancies there? Is it possible to bypass the Masters requirement (looks very common in the region) if already have 1yoe?

Recruitment happens year-round, with the main recruiting cycles happening 4-6 months before the end of the semester. Generally you'll need at least 2 yoe to avoid needing a master's. NL is usually quite strict on this, but sometimes in Europe there are bachelor analyst positions.

It is definitely possible to bypass the Masters requirement. I think this mostly depends on the type of consulting. Technology related consulting does not always require a Master degree, while strategy consulting (very often) does. My (non-Dutch) girlfriend went to a big4 straight after her Bachelor without any work experience.
